Beekeeping is a lucrative and sustainable business activity, mainly due to the low start-up costs.  It is a useful means of strengthening and creating people,s livelihoods. In Sudan, there is an estimated 50,000 beekeepers, rearing 200,000 colonies. The Forage carrying capacity is 2.6  colony/hectare. The estimated forest area is around 71.0 million hectares and the irrigated land is about 1.9 million hectares. This total area is capable of producing 2.8 million MT of honey annually; this is worth US$1 billion and equivalent to 18 million barrels of petrol. Despite these potentialities, Sudan is ranked least in Africa for contribution of apiculture to the economy: the beekeeping sector is rudimentary and un exploited. This paper deals with how beekeeping can contribute towards building peace and prosperity in Sudan. It aims to analyse the current beekeeping situation and challenges, and forward  recommendations for policy-makers to set a strategy for conservation and sustainable utilisation of this resource.
